Overview of the role 

Phoenix is a leading UK IT solutions and managed service provider, with a deep specialism in the public sector. We work with organisations across government, healthcare, defence, public safety, education, housing, and the charity sector - helping them modernise with confidence across cloud, data and AI, cyber security, and managed services. 

Through strategic partnerships with the world's leading technology providers - and a trusted place on the major public sector frameworks - our work has a direct impact on the services that millions of people rely on every day. 

Due to continued growth, we are hiring a new  Senior Consultant who specialises in on-premise and hybrid infrastructure solutions. In this role you will work with cross-functional teams to deliver innovative solutions, ensuring exceptional customer satisfaction and quality of work. 

What will you be doing? 

  • Lead end‑to‑end customer engagements, from presales and design through delivery and handover 
  • Design secure, resilient on‑premises, hybrid, and cloud infrastructure solutions aligned to customer and operational requirements 
  • Deliver and support infrastructure platforms covering virtualisation, networking, core services, and Microsoft technologies 
  • Architect and implement high availability, backup, and disaster recovery solutions across complex environments 
  • Lead or support infrastructure deployments, migrations, upgrades, and modernisation initiatives 
  • Provide technical leadership, governance, and risk management across all stages of delivery 
  • Produce high‑quality technical documentation and act as a trusted advisor to technical and non‑technical stakeholders

What are we looking for? 

The right person for this role will have significant experience in this sector and will have a deep understanding of End User computing (EUC), Virtual Desktop Infrastructure (VDI) deployment and physical infrastructure. 

 

Key Skills: 

  • Strong experience designing and delivering enterprise on‑premises and hybrid infrastructure solutions 
  • Advanced virtualisation expertise across VMware (ideally VMware Cloud Foundation) and Hyper‑V 
  • Deep Microsoft infrastructure skills, including Windows Server, Active Directory, DNS, DHCP, PKI, and VPNs 
  • Strong enterprise networking capability across routing, switching, security, WAN, SD‑WAN, wireless, and cloud networking 
  • Expert knowledge of backup, recovery, and disaster recovery using Veeam technologies 
  • Practical automation experience using PowerShell, Python, Ansible, or similar tools 
  • Proven ability to troubleshoot complex, cross‑platform infrastructure and networking issues 
  • Strong customer‑facing consultancy skills, with the ability to lead engagements and communicate effectively at all levels

*Important* BPSS Check 

As part of our recruitment process due to the nature of the work we do, all employees are required to undertake a Baseline Personal Security Standard (BPSS) check. While some employees require further security clearance, the BPSS check is a must-have requirement and all offers of employment are conditional pending the passing of this check
